The story of William Patterson began in 1746 in Augusta, Virginia, USA, with parents William Patterson and Mary Roby. As an adult, William Patterson wed Martha Cummins Patterson, Lucy Patterson (Johnson), "Ginny"Jane Fletcher, Virginia Cummins and Jane Culton. Their household included James Patterson, Virginia Patterson-Carnes, Virginia "Jenny" Patterson, Skelton Patterson, Tilman Patterson, William G Patterson, James Patterson, JAMES WILLIAM Patterson, Anna Patterson, Anna Patterson, George Martin Patterson, Jackson Miller Patterson, Tilman Patterson, George Martin Patterson, Jackson Miller Patterson, Ursula Patterson and Ginny Patterson. William Patterson's life came to an end in 1840 in Knox, Kentucky, USA.
